•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Küsüratlı sayıları yuvarlama

  • Konbuyu başlatan Konbuyu başlatan pcci
  • Başlangıç tarihi Başlangıç tarihi
Katılım
13 Kasım 2004
Mesajlar
47
Merhaba arkadaşlar.
Bir sorum olacaktı.access'ta sql deyiminde bir alana işlem yapıp sonucu yazdırıyorum. (Yüzde oranı) Fakat virgülden sonra 10 basamaklı çok küsüratlı sayılar çıkıyor. Virgülden sonra ilk iki basamaktaki rakam yazılsın. Yuvarlama yapılsın. Ã?rneğin 0,125556789 yazmasın da 0,13 yazsın. Bunu nasıl yapabiliriz? Þimdiden çok teşekkür ederim. Bekliyorum...
 
Merhaba;

Access ile ilgilenmediğim için detayını bilemiyorum ama, bir şekilde veriyi biçimlendirmeniz gerekiyor....

[vb:1:12b34950a3]Sub Test()
x = 0.236589
x = Format(x, "0.00")
MsgBox x
End Sub
[/vb:1:12b34950a3]

veya;

[vb:1:12b34950a3]Sub Test2()
x = 0.236589
x = Format(x, "0.00%")
MsgBox x
End Sub
[/vb:1:12b34950a3]
 
Teşekkürler Raider. Ama tahmin ediyorum sql'de bir yazılım şekli vardır.
İşte aşagıdaki işlemin sonucu küsüratlı çıkıyor. Nasıl istediğim formata çetirebilirim?
((sum([1k243])+sum([1k244])+sum([1k245])+sum([1k246])+sum([1k247]))*100) / sum([birinci pisirim]) as 1_Oran,
 
access in kendi özelliği yapıyor bunu. ayarı ekte
 
Geri
Üst